如何在一个http请求中,设置头信息

如何在一个http请求中,设置头信息,第1张

首先,我们先看一下http的头信息到底是什么:HTTP(HyperTextTransferProtocol) 即超文本传输协议,目前网页传输的的通用协议。HTTP协议采用了请求/响应模型,浏览器或其他客户端发出请求,服务器给与响应。就整个网络资源传输而 言,包括message-header和message-body两部分。首先传递message- header,即http header消息。http header 消息通常被分为4个部分: general header, request header, response header, entity header。但是这种分法就理解而言,感觉界限不太明确,根据日常使用,大体分为Request和Response两部分。在通常的servlet/jsp应用中,我们只是从http的header中取得信息,如果要设置信息,需要用到HttpClient,具体的设置方法如下:HttpResponse response = null HttpGet get = new HttpGet(url) get", 80) HttpHost wikipediaEn = new HttpHost("en", 80) cm.setMaxPerRoute(new HttpRoute(googleResearch), 30) cm.setMaxPerRoute(new HttpRoute(wikipediaEn), 50)DefaultHttpClient client = new DefaultHttpClient(cm)

在下图对请求或响应进行选择,当勾选后,则在调试界面就可以对请求头或响应体参数进行修改 4.重新发起请求,就会进入到Charles设置好的断点界面 5.当修改参数执行后,既可以在页面也可以在Charles页面查看本次调试结果。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/zaji/7061528.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-01
下一篇 2023-04-01

发表评论

登录后才能评论

评论列表(0条)

保存